leverage

English

  1. 🔊 investing with borrowed money as a way to amplify potential gains (at the risk of greater losses)
  2. 🔊 strategic advantage
    “relatively small groups can sometimes exert immense political leverage”
  3. 🔊 the mechanical advantage gained by being in a position to use a lever
  4. 🔊 provide with leverage
    “We need to leverage this company”
  5. 🔊 supplement with leverage
    “leverage the money that is already available”
